Method: sharedAlbums.list

Mencantumkan semua album bersama yang tersedia di tab Berbagi di aplikasi Google Foto pengguna.

Permintaan HTTP

GET https://photoslibrary.googleapis.com/v1/sharedAlbums

URL menggunakan sintaksis gRPC Transcoding.

Parameter kueri

Parameter
pageSize

integer

Jumlah maksimum album yang akan ditampilkan dalam respons. Lebih sedikit album yang mungkin ditampilkan daripada jumlah yang ditentukan. pageSize default adalah 20, maksimumnya adalah 50.

pageToken

string

Token kelanjutan untuk mendapatkan halaman hasil berikutnya. Menambahkan ini ke permintaan akan menampilkan baris setelah pageToken. pageToken harus menjadi nilai yang ditampilkan dalam parameter nextPageToken sebagai respons terhadap permintaan listSharedAlbums.

excludeNonAppCreatedData

boolean

Jika disetel, hasilnya akan mengecualikan item media yang tidak dibuat oleh aplikasi ini. Nilai defaultnya adalah false (semua album ditampilkan). Kolom ini diabaikan jika cakupan photoslibrary.readonly.appcreateddata digunakan.

Isi permintaan

Isi permintaan harus kosong.

Isi respons

Daftar album bersama yang diminta.

Jika berhasil, isi respons memuat data dengan struktur berikut:

Representasi JSON
{
  "sharedAlbums": [
    {
      object (Album)
    }
  ],
  "nextPageToken": string
}
Kolom
sharedAlbums[]

object (Album)

Hanya output. Daftar album bersama.

nextPageToken

string

Hanya output. Token yang akan digunakan untuk mendapatkan kumpulan album bersama berikutnya. Diisi jika ada lebih banyak album bersama yang dapat diambil untuk permintaan ini.

Cakupan otorisasi

Memerlukan salah satu cakupan OAuth berikut:

  • https://www.googleapis.com/auth/photoslibrary
  • https://www.googleapis.com/auth/photoslibrary.readonly
  • https://www.googleapis.com/auth/photoslibrary.readonly.appcreateddata